Charter Market and Revenue Impact:
- The charter market weakened during the fourth quarter of 2024, impacting Safe Bulkers' revenues and profitability.
- The softening market, particularly in the Panamax segment, contributed to the decline in revenues.

Fleet Renewal and Environmental Upgrades:
- Safe Bulkers benefited from premium charter rates for environmentally upgraded vessels and Phase 3 newbuilds.
- The company's policy of renewing and upgrading its fleet provided operational and financial advantages.

Market Conditions and Demand Outlook:
- The company anticipates a soft freight market in the following quarters due to supply growing faster than demand.
- The focus on fleet decarbonization and energy-efficient newbuilds is expected to increase, influenced by factors like the MEPC 83 decision on global fuel standards.

Supply-Demand Dynamics:
- The dry bulk fleet is projected to grow by about 2.8% annually from 2025 to 2026, outpacing demand growth.
- Ageing of the fleet and environmental regulations, such as a 1% fall in fleet speed, are expected to affect supply and demand dynamics.
